A burglar alarm linked to your mobile phone - BlueLabs develops the system Now your mobile phone can be connected to an alarm system - an intelligent way of exploiting mobile technology for a real benefit. BlueLabs (formerly Frontec Teknik) has developed a system for Mobile Notifier that allows intelligent alarm communication via the mobile Internet. The system analyses alarm signals and passes them on to wherever the recipient wants. The system opens up great opportunities for smart security solutions for both individuals and companies. The system receives alarm signals from an alarm transmitter, analyses the alarm and forwards it on the basis of a profile defined by the user. The alarm messages can be sent to a mobile phone using SMS messaging, pre- recorded voice messages, via e-mail or directly to an alarm centre. The platform is very flexible and allows alarm and notification services to be tailored to the customer's exact wishes via the Internet. BlueLabs is a high-tech company focusing on intelligent communication. We supply top-level competence for applications within the areas of mobile IT, advanced telecoms, intelligent vehicles and intelligent homes. BlueLabs develops technically creative and advanced solutions within intelligent communication, strengthening the innovativeness of our clients and allowing them to develop their business further. BlueLabs has around 300 employees at offices in Gothenburg, Linköping, Luleå, Pajala and Stockholm and is part of the Frontec Group (formerly Frontec Teknik).
